Output dd5aaa6591d941ac4f7535c5c394a925b90ff38efd61925c77d6a9f701e03d01:2

value
661593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a34423a66b4b5a6e2a19f2bf2dbab4ecec7501a7 OP_EQUAL
address
3GaHhDBGQxqBdzvYMWMNynwRPove8cr7cJ
transaction
dd5aaa6591d941ac4f7535c5c394a925b90ff38efd61925c77d6a9f701e03d01
confirmations
300334
spent
true